Hope this would help anyone who plans to replace their car battery.

Today I replaced my battery with exide 12v 45Ah because my prevous ACdelco started to give trouble after a 4 and a half years troublefree service.

Exide original price was 11,550/-

After the discount 9,000/-

Also 400/- reduction for the old battery.

Got 1 year warrenty + battmobile service.

i wanted to buy a battery 90Ah for kia sporatge. the original battery was a "Rocket" a trade name of the globe battery company

checked prices in several places, and a one battery vendor him self told Uni****al battery shop at punchi borella do most of sales. how ever when i checked from them, their prices were not cheap.( they agreed to give a maximum of 25% for panasonic battery).

after doing a resonably extensive market survey i found these facts

Panasonic ,Amaron and excide-milage gives the highest warrenty- 2yrs replacement plus 2yrs pro-Rata( ie: divide the purchase price by 48 and deduct the amount remaining from the 4yr period in replacement battery price)

they buy the old battery

if locally made-1000-1800Rs or imported battery 800-1500

prices i recieved

panasonic(thailand) MF 16200- 19500

yuasa (japan)MF 16800- 19500 2yr warrenty

exide normal 14000-16500 1yr

exide mf 14500- 18000 2yr

amaron(india) MF 17500 19800

amaron (india)normal 14500 1yr

FB (thai) 16500

there were many other batteries where iwasnt intersted hence no memory on prices

at the end i found this small shop in kottawa town after seen an internet advert and bought the panasonic for 14700 (after reduction for old battery) with 4yr DSL warrenty.

hope this will help someone
